Why Walls and Ceilings Matter in a Cleanroom

First off, let's talk about why walls and ceilings are such a big deal in a cleanroom. A cleanroom is designed to maintain a specific level of cleanliness by controlling the amount of airborne particles, temperature, humidity, and pressure. Walls and ceilings act as the physical barriers that separate the cleanroom environment from the outside world. They prevent contaminants from entering the cleanroom and also help in maintaining the internal conditions.

Material Requirements

When it comes to choosing materials for walls and ceilings in a cleanroom, there are several factors to consider.

Non - Porous and Smooth Surfaces

The materials used should have non - porous and smooth surfaces. This is because porous materials can trap particles, making them difficult to clean. Smooth surfaces, on the other hand, are easy to wipe down and keep clean. For example, materials like stainless steel and high - pressure laminate are commonly used for cleanroom walls and ceilings because they have smooth, non - porous surfaces.

Chemical Resistance

Cleanrooms often use various chemicals for cleaning and disinfection. So, the wall and ceiling materials need to be resistant to these chemicals. If the materials are not chemically resistant, they can degrade over time, releasing particles into the cleanroom environment. For instance, in a Pharmaceutical Cleanroom, where strong disinfectants are used regularly, the walls and ceilings must be able to withstand these chemicals without any damage.

Fire Resistance

Fire safety is always a concern in any building, and cleanrooms are no exception. The wall and ceiling materials should have a certain level of fire resistance. This not only protects the people working in the cleanroom but also the valuable equipment and products inside. Many cleanrooms use fire - rated drywall or other fire - resistant materials for their walls and ceilings.

Static Dissipative Properties

In some cleanrooms, especially those in the electronics industry, static electricity can be a major problem. Static charges can attract particles and even damage sensitive electronic components. So, the wall and ceiling materials may need to have static dissipative properties. This helps to prevent the build - up of static electricity and keeps the cleanroom environment stable.

Design Requirements

The design of the walls and ceilings in a cleanroom is just as important as the materials used.

Seamless Construction

Seamless construction is highly desirable in a cleanroom. Seams can be a breeding ground for bacteria and a place where particles can accumulate. By using seamless wall and ceiling panels, we can minimize these potential problem areas. For example, some cleanroom systems use pre - fabricated panels that are joined together in a way that creates a seamless surface.

Easy Access for Maintenance

Cleanrooms require regular maintenance, including inspections, repairs, and upgrades. So, the walls and ceilings should be designed in a way that allows easy access to the mechanical, electrical, and plumbing systems behind them. This might involve using removable panels or hatches that can be opened without causing too much disruption to the cleanroom environment.

Proper Insulation

Insulation is crucial for maintaining the temperature and humidity levels inside the cleanroom. Good insulation helps to reduce energy consumption by preventing heat transfer between the cleanroom and the outside environment. It also helps to minimize condensation, which can lead to mold growth and other issues. Insulated wall and ceiling panels are commonly used in cleanrooms to achieve these goals.

Installation Requirements

Even the best materials and designs won't work if the walls and ceilings are not installed correctly.

Air - Tight Installation

An air - tight installation is essential to prevent the leakage of air and contaminants. All joints and seams should be sealed properly using appropriate sealants. This helps to maintain the pressure differential inside the cleanroom, which is important for controlling the flow of air and preventing the entry of particles.

Alignment and Leveling

The walls and ceilings must be installed with proper alignment and leveling. Any misalignment can create gaps and uneven surfaces, which can compromise the cleanliness of the cleanroom. Professional installers use precise measuring tools and techniques to ensure that the walls and ceilings are installed perfectly.

Compliance with Standards

There are various standards and regulations that govern the construction of cleanrooms, such as ISO 14644. The installation of the walls and ceilings must comply with these standards. This includes everything from the thickness of the materials to the way the panels are joined together.

Different Industry Requirements

The requirements for walls and ceilings can vary depending on the industry in which the cleanroom is used.

Food Manufacturing Cleanroom

In a Food Manufacturing Cleanroom, the walls and ceilings need to be made of materials that are safe for food contact. They should also be easy to clean and disinfect to prevent the growth of bacteria and other pathogens. Additionally, since food manufacturing often involves high - humidity environments, the materials need to be resistant to moisture.

Pharmaceutical Cleanroom

As mentioned earlier, Pharmaceutical Cleanroom have strict requirements for cleanliness and chemical resistance. The walls and ceilings must be able to withstand the use of strong disinfectants and prevent the growth of microorganisms. They also need to be designed to minimize the risk of cross - contamination between different production areas.
